Ep 20 - The 21 Martyrs of Libya: Faith on the Shore of Death

Dec 9, 2025

On a quiet beach in Libya in 2015, twenty-one men knelt before the waves — ordinary workers whose final whispered words became a testimony heard around the world:

“Ya Rabbi Yasu… Lord Jesus.”


In this episode, we tell their story with reverence, depth, and historical faithfulness.

From their journey out of Egypt, to their courage in captivity, to the final moment where heaven stood in silence, this is not a story of death — but a story of unshakeable faith.


Featuring immersive sound design, cinematic storytelling, and the real hymn sung by the martyrs in their final days, this episode honours their sacrifice and preserves their voices for generations to come.
